About the role
This position supports US Army programs and focuses on configurations management, logistics, engineering, technical support, and management of advanced networks for military vehicles and equipment. It involves working across multiple locations.
Responsibilities
- Manage design drawings, engineering changes, and notices.
- Work closely with program management, systems engineers, quality managers, draftsmen, and design/manufacturing engineers in a concurrent engineering environment.
- Develop and administer Configuration Management Plans.
- Prepare for and conduct major configuration audits.
Requirements
- U.S. Citizenship is required.
- A minimum of 5 years of relevant experience, including 2 years in a supervisory or management capacity.
- A Bachelor's Degree from an accredited college or university in Engineering Design, or 1 academic year at an accredited college or university in an accredited Engineering Design related post-secondary program.
- Ability to obtain a secret clearance as needed.
